Team — cut-over for TrailNote offline mode is done. Sync queue drained clean Sunday night; conflict resolver handled all 312 pending survey edits. Old endpoint is dark. Field crews in the Marwick pilot confirmed map tiles cache correctly. One retry-storm blip, patched. Remaining task: rotate the staging credentials. Current production configuration for the sync service follows below.

config for taguf-tafof:
zorath:
  log_level: error
  metrics_host: metrics.zorath.zemvarlabs.internal
  pin: 5550
  pool_size: 32

Handover: flaky DNS on the Ostrel cluster. Hey, welcome aboard — quick context. Lookups for internal services intermittently time out, roughly every few hours. We suspect the Quillby resolver cache is evicting entries under memory pressure; bumping the cache size helped but didn't fix it. Packet captures live on the debug box. To unlock the encrypted capture archive, use the passphrase given below.

unlock words, hahap-yawig: pelix-kelion-tamys-jorix-julok

**Key Ceremony Checklist — Item 4 (RateStash)**

Rotate the encryption key for RateStash, the tax-rate lookup cache. Confirm both custodians present. Verify the old key decrypts the current jurisdiction table before destroying it. If decryption fails, halt and restore from the sealed backup. Do not proceed past this step without a clean restore. Unsealing the backup requires the recovery passphrase below.

unlock words, fahop-yageg: ralwyn-kelath

This PR wires up the new turnstile counter for Larkspur Stadium's entry gates. Quick summary for the security review: counts are now signed at the gate controller and verified before aggregation, so a compromised kiosk can't inflate attendance figures. I also added replay protection with a sliding nonce window — that's the part I'd love extra eyes on, since the window size trades memory against replay risk. Everything's behind the `gatecount_v2` flag. The tuning constants we're shipping with are these.

tuning constants:
RATE_LIMITS = {
    "ralwyn": 5,
    "zorael": 2,
}